Central government doctors have rebutted a health ministry claim that they work at most for 40 hours a week, saying their work hours often add up to 100 or even 120 hours a week. A resident doctor at the Safdarjung Hospital said that such inhuman work pressure is an invitation to medical negligence. There is a paucity of doctors and staff at the hospitals, because of which the resident doctors are overburdened,” he said. The government should regulate the work hours to ensure that the doctors provide quality care.”
